New foreign hitter Patrick Wisdom of the KIA Tigers expressed his strong ambition ahead of the 2025 season. He raised fans' expectations by vowing to hit 45 home runs in his debut season of the KBO League.
When asked by commentator Park Yong-taek on KBSN Sports YouTube recently whether he could hit 40 homers, Wisdom showed his number and promised with a smile, saying, "I will hit as many as my number." His number is 45, which means that he will soon become the home run king of the KBO League.
After winning the combined championship last year, Kia made a big decision in the process of reorganizing its team. It gave up renewing its contract with Socrates Brito, who contributed to the team's victory by posting a batting average of 0.320, 63 homers, 270 RBIs and 40 steals for the past three years, and hired Wizdom, a slugger with a huge right-handedness. Brought to the KBO league by investing 1 million U.S. dollars, Wizdom is considered a slugger who hit more than 20 homers for three consecutive years in the Major League.
As a right-handed hitter with strong slugging capability, Wizdom can expect good performance against left-handed pitchers. KIA is trying to maximize the destructive power of its batters by establishing a strong central batting line centered on Wizdom.토토사이트
KIA already has the best batting lineup. Kim Do-young, who hit 38 home runs last year, will challenge for 40 to 40 steals in the 2025 season, while veterans Choi Hyung-woo and Na Sung-bum are also expected to hit 20 or more home runs. Notably, if Na ends the season healthy after failing to play full-time due to injury for the past two seasons, there is a chance for 30 home runs.
If Wisdom hits more than 30 home runs at the center line, KIA's batting lineup is expected to become stronger. Coach Lee Bum-ho said in an interview with a media outlet, "I am very satisfied if I hit about 30 home runs with a batting average of 0.280." On top of that, if Wisdom hits a confident target of 45 home runs, he can become one of the leading home run hitters in the KBO league.
KIA, which won its second unified championship since its foundation last year, aims to win its second consecutive title in the 2025 season. If the 45 home runs predicted by Wisdom become a reality, KIA is likely to establish itself as a team with the best batting lineup in the KBO league, not just a favorite.
